The International Libyan Conference on Electronic Government

Records Management

• Common uses

• Identify, classify, preserve records (documents)

• Retrieve records for auditing; purge records over time

• Maintain evidence of contracts, certificates, legal content • Benefits

• Compliance support with audit history

• Integrity via security and roles (i.e. file / write, search / read) • Highlights

• “RM for the rest of us” - dramatically lower cost • Multiple import points - web, CIFS, email (IMAP)

Case Study: Bristol City Council

• Electronic documents and online

team collaboration is a key enabling component of the council's plan to shave £70 million off its annual

operating budget.

• Alfresco software will allow staff to access electronic documents online from any location, reducing

dependence on paper, and it will give project teams the ability to

share information virtually through a collaboration platform.

1. Landlords applying for licences for houses in multiple occupation will be able to submit their applications online, with Alfresco managing the workflow for that documentation. 2. Staff performing equipment

servicing and maintenance repairs on council properties can upload images such as photographs and gas certificates captured on PDAs.
